Smoking two 10lb butts today. It was 17 F out with a wind chill factor of -2 when I started the coals this morning at 6am. Winds are anywhere from 25 - 35 mph. Good thing the Bandera is heavy, wouldn't want to have to be chasing the smoker around. Brrrr Nellie!
eek.gif
Even with gloves on my fingers were hurting by the time I got back inside.



Butts were rubbed and injected with ShooterRick's SBC. Will be smoking at 250 (hopefully) with a mix of white oak and cherry.
